SecurityFunctions

Functions

Link copied to clipboard
Link copied to clipboard

Describes the suppression rule API Version: 2019-01-01-preview.

suspend fun getAlertsSuppressionRule(alertsSuppressionRuleName: String): GetAlertsSuppressionRuleResult
Link copied to clipboard

Security Application over a given scope API Version: 2022-07-01-preview.

suspend fun getApplication(applicationId: String): GetApplicationResult
Link copied to clipboard

Security assessment on a resource API Version: 2020-01-01.

suspend fun getAssessment(assessmentName: String, expand: String? = null, resourceId: String): GetAssessmentResult
Link copied to clipboard

Security Assignment on a resource group over a given scope API Version: 2021-08-01-preview.

suspend fun getAssignment(assignmentId: String, resourceGroupName: String): GetAssignmentResult
Link copied to clipboard

The security automation resource. API Version: 2019-01-01-preview.

suspend fun getAutomation(automationName: String, resourceGroupName: String): GetAutomationResult
Link copied to clipboard

The connector setting API Version: 2020-01-01-preview.

suspend fun getConnector(connectorName: String): GetConnectorResult
Link copied to clipboard

Custom Assessment Automation API Version: 2021-07-01-preview.

suspend fun getCustomAssessmentAutomation(customAssessmentAutomationName: String, resourceGroupName: String): GetCustomAssessmentAutomationResult
Link copied to clipboard

Custom entity store assignment API Version: 2021-07-01-preview.

suspend fun getCustomEntityStoreAssignment(customEntityStoreAssignmentName: String, resourceGroupName: String): GetCustomEntityStoreAssignmentResult
Link copied to clipboard

The device security group resource API Version: 2019-08-01.

suspend fun getDeviceSecurityGroup(deviceSecurityGroupName: String, resourceId: String): GetDeviceSecurityGroupResult
Link copied to clipboard

Configures how to correlate scan data and logs with resources associated with the subscription. API Version: 2021-01-15-preview.

suspend fun getIngestionSetting(ingestionSettingName: String): GetIngestionSettingResult
Link copied to clipboard

IoT Security solution configuration and resource information. API Version: 2019-08-01.

suspend fun getIotSecuritySolution(resourceGroupName: String, solutionName: String): GetIotSecuritySolutionResult
Link copied to clipboard
Link copied to clipboard

The security connector resource. API Version: 2021-07-01-preview.

suspend fun getSecurityConnector(resourceGroupName: String, securityConnectorName: String): GetSecurityConnectorResult
Link copied to clipboard

Security Application over a given scope API Version: 2022-07-01-preview.

suspend fun getSecurityConnectorApplication(applicationId: String, resourceGroupName: String, securityConnectorName: String): GetSecurityConnectorApplicationResult
Link copied to clipboard

Contact details and configurations for notifications coming from Microsoft Defender for Cloud. API Version: 2020-01-01-preview.

suspend fun getSecurityContact(securityContactName: String): GetSecurityContactResult
Link copied to clipboard

Describes the server vulnerability assessment details on a resource API Version: 2020-01-01.

suspend fun getServerVulnerabilityAssessment(resourceGroupName: String, resourceName: String, resourceNamespace: String, resourceType: String, serverVulnerabilityAssessment: String): GetServerVulnerabilityAssessmentResult
Link copied to clipboard

Security Standard on a resource API Version: 2021-08-01-preview.

suspend fun getStandard(argument: suspend GetStandardPlainArgsBuilder.() -> Unit): GetStandardResult
suspend fun getStandard(resourceGroupName: String, standardId: String): GetStandardResult
Link copied to clipboard

Configures where to store the OMS agent data for workspaces under a scope API Version: 2017-08-01-preview.

suspend fun getWorkspaceSetting(workspaceSettingName: String): GetWorkspaceSettingResult
Link copied to clipboard

Configures how to correlate scan data and logs with resources associated with the subscription. API Version: 2021-01-15-preview.